What is the OBD II System?

The OBD II system, or On-Board Diagnostics II, is a standardized system used in most vehicles manufactured after 1996. It’s essentially your car’s internal health monitor, constantly checking for potential issues and storing diagnostic codes.

Why is the OBD II System Important?

Think of it as having a doctor for your car. The OBD II system can help diagnose a range of problems, from engine misfires and sensor failures to emissions issues. This can save you time and money in the long run by catching problems early on before they escalate into more serious, and costly, repairs.

How Does the OBD II System Work?

The system is a network of sensors, actuators, and a control module that constantly monitors your car’s systems. If a problem is detected, a diagnostic trouble code (DTC) is stored. This code can be read using a diagnostic scanner, which can then be used to decipher the problem and guide you towards the solution.

How to Use an OBD II Scanner on a 2017 Kia Optima

OBD II scanners come in various forms, from basic code readers to advanced diagnostic tools. For a 2017 Kia Optima, you’ll want a compatible scanner that can read the specific protocols used in your vehicle.

Here’s a step-by-step guide:

  1. Locate the OBD II Port: On most 2017 Kia Optima models, the OBD II port is located under the dashboard, usually near the steering column. It’s a 16-pin connector.

  2. Plug in the Scanner: Connect your OBD II scanner to the port. Some scanners require you to turn the ignition key to the “on” position.

  3. Select the Vehicle Information: Follow the instructions of your scanner to input your vehicle’s year, make, and model.

  4. Read the Codes: The scanner will display any diagnostic trouble codes (DTCs) that have been stored in your car’s computer.

  5. Interpret the Codes: Use the scanner’s built-in code library or consult an online database to understand what the codes mean.

  6. Take Action: The codes will provide information about the problem, allowing you to either attempt a DIY fix or consult a mechanic for professional assistance.

Understanding Common OBD II Codes for a 2017 Kia Optima

P0300 – Random/Multiple Cylinder Misfire Detected: This code suggests that the engine is experiencing misfires in one or more cylinders.
P0171 – System Too Lean (Bank 1): This indicates that the air-fuel mixture is too lean, which can lead to performance issues.
P0420 – Catalyst System Efficiency Below Threshold (Bank 1): This code suggests that the catalytic converter is not functioning properly, which can impact emissions.

Troubleshooting Tips for OBD II Codes on a 2017 Kia Optima

P0300 – Random/Multiple Cylinder Misfire Detected:

  • Spark Plugs: Inspect and replace worn-out or damaged spark plugs.
  • Ignition Coils: Check the ignition coils for cracks or signs of damage.
  • Fuel Injectors: Inspect the fuel injectors for clogging or leaks.
  • Fuel System: Ensure the fuel system is free of clogs and providing adequate fuel pressure.

P0171 – System Too Lean (Bank 1):

  • Mass Airflow Sensor (MAF): Check for contamination or damage to the MAF sensor.
  • Oxygen Sensors: Inspect the oxygen sensors for malfunction or aging.
  • Vacuum Leaks: Look for leaks in the intake manifold or vacuum lines.
  • Fuel Pressure Regulator: Inspect the fuel pressure regulator for proper operation.

P0420 – Catalyst System Efficiency Below Threshold (Bank 1):

  • Catalytic Converter: If the catalytic converter is damaged or clogged, it may need to be replaced.
  • Oxygen Sensors: Check the upstream and downstream oxygen sensors for proper operation.
  • Exhaust System: Inspect the exhaust system for leaks or blockages.

Frequently Asked Questions About the 2017 Kia Optima Obd Ii System

1. What does it mean if my engine light comes on?

The engine light, also known as the malfunction indicator lamp (MIL), signals that a problem has been detected by the OBD II system. You can use a scanner to read the diagnostic codes to identify the specific issue.

2. Can I reset the engine light myself?

You can often reset the engine light by disconnecting the battery for a few minutes. However, this only clears the code, not the problem. If the issue persists, the light will likely come back on.

3. How often should I have my OBD II system checked?

It’s a good idea to have your OBD II system checked at least once a year, or more frequently if you notice any performance issues.

4. Can I use a basic code reader on my 2017 Kia Optima?

Most basic code readers will work with a 2017 Kia Optima, but some may not be able to read all the codes or provide as much information as a more advanced scanner.
